Careful review requested: the RateMirror parity checker now fetches competitor pages through our egress proxy, and all scraped payloads are sanitized before storage, which addresses the injection vector you flagged. Retry and throttle behavior is fully config-driven so we never exceed polite crawl limits. The constants governing request pacing and backoff are defined here.

tuning constants:
RATE_LIMITS = {
    "wenwyn": 1,
    "zorix": 10,
    "oliix": 2,
    "holael": 10,
}

AddrSnap provides address autocomplete for the Kestrel checkout. Queries go to the Lockhart geocoding backend over mTLS; raw keystrokes are never logged. Rate limiting is enforced at the edge, 10 req/s per session. The widget's server proxy authenticates to Lockhart with a rotating credential, rotated monthly by ops. Configure the proxy by adding this line to its env file:

secret setting of yajog-taguf: ARCHIVE_KEY3=051

Subject: Lanternflag cut-over summary

Team — the cut-over of the Lanternflag rollout framework to the Ostermark cluster completed last night without rollback. All percentage ramps were frozen during the window, and Priya verified that evaluation latency stayed under the agreed budget. Please review the diff carefully before we unfreeze ramps tomorrow; one stale rule was removed deliberately. For your review, the configuration now active in production is listed below.

service settings:
[oliix]
team = noveth
access_code = ac_4de949
host = oliix.novachq.corp
port = 8080
owner = wenir.casion
peer = wenys.lumicstack.corp

Ticket: Staging env misconfigured for Siftgate bloom filter

The bloom layer in front of the Pellet KV store is rejecting all lookups in staging because the env file was copied from the dev template without credentials. False-positive tuning values are fine; only the auth line is missing. To unblock the weekly demo, the Pellet admission secret must be set on the following line.

env line for yaguf-fajop: LEDGER_TOKEN13=fb08984397349